Scope and Contents

Several young dancers from Lawton, Oklahoma are spending their summer vacations attending dance workshops in various locations across the country, including New York City, North Carolina, Texas, and Kansas. One dancer received a full scholarship to study dance at Southern Methodist University. Additionally, LaDonna Harris, wife of Lawton's U.S. Senator, received the National Education Association's Human Rights Award. Other news includes entertainment at Marlow's Fourth of July celebration and a hair-styling contest winner in Altus.
